Enzootic Pneumonia (EP)

Uncontrolled, M. hyopneumoniae causes a moderate pneumonia, depresses the pig's immunodefence system, predisposes to other infections, slows growth rate and reduces feed conversion efficiency (FCE) by 5-10%.
 

However, in the field situation, nearly 40-50% of lesions are infected with secondary invaders, particularly Pasteurella multocida . These cause serious broncho-pneumonia and increase the severity of the porcine respiratory disease complex (PRDC). Growth and FCE are further reduced, while mortality and the need for additional treatments are increased.Ā
